01 · THE DISPATCH

Belarusian President Alexander Lukashenko met with Chinese President Xi Jinping in Beijing on Monday morning, as reported by Asaf Rozentzweig (N12). The meeting was confirmed through a single reporting source, with no further details on agenda or outcomes yet available. Belarus has deepened its ties with China in recent years, particularly as Minsk faces increasing international isolation following its support for Russia's war in Ukraine. The visit signals continued high-level engagement between the two countries.
